Output 95730334d7ec068fa48931888597e1722dd0515fd2162ce5abad4df34044909e:11

value
3390
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6037fcafabbc19fd3f2e997bd48c66766e438940bbbc93a18cae98a0d5412b60
address
bc1pvqmletathsvl60ewn9aafrrxwehy8z2qhw7f8gvv46v2p42p9dsqy8ful7
transaction
95730334d7ec068fa48931888597e1722dd0515fd2162ce5abad4df34044909e
spent
true